What is a business intelligence contractor?

A Business Intelligence (BI) Contractor is a data expert hired on a temporary basis to help organizations collect, analyze, and visualize business data for better decision-making. They work with databases, reporting tools, and dashboards to transform raw data into actionable insights. BI Contractors often use tools like SQL, Power BI, Tableau, or Python to automate reporting and support business strategies. Their role may also include developing data models, optimizing ETL processes, and collaborating with stakeholders to define key performance indicators (KPIs). This position is ideal for companies that need specialized BI skills for a specific project or short-term need.

What types of projects or assignments do business intelligence contractors typically work on?

Business Intelligence Contractors are often engaged in projects such as developing interactive dashboards, creating data models, implementing analytics solutions, and providing data-driven recommendations to improve business operations. They may work on short-term assignments focused on specific business initiatives, or on longer-term engagements supporting ongoing analytics and reporting needs. Projects frequently require collaborating with cross-functional teams, understanding business requirements, and translating them into effective data solutions. This variety allows contractors to build broad expertise and work with a range of industries, making the role both dynamic and rewarding.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the business intelligence contractor position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Business Intelligence Contractor, you need strong analytical skills, expertise in data modeling and reporting, and a degree in a related field such as computer science, statistics, or business. Mastery of technical tools like SQL, Power BI, Tableau, and experience with data warehouses is typically required, and certifications in business intelligence or analytics add value. Excellent problem-solving abilities, effective communication, and adaptability are crucial soft skills for working with diverse clients and stakeholders. These attributes enable contractors to deliver actionable insights and solutions that drive business performance across various organizations.
